Charles “Chad” Lowe (born January 15, 1968) is an American television actor, and the brother of actor Rob Lowe. Lowe began his acting career in his teens, co-starring with Tommy Lee Jones and Robert Urich in the 1987 made-for-TV film April Morning, which depicted the battle of Lexington in the American Revolutionary War.
